#include <openbr/plugins/openbr_internal.h>
namespace br
{
/*!
* \ingroup transforms
* \brief Caches Transform::project() results.
* \author Josh Klontz \cite jklontz
*/
class CacheTransform : public MetaTransform
{
Q_OBJECT
Q_PROPERTY(br::Transform* transform READ get_transform WRITE set_transform RESET reset_transform)
BR_PROPERTY(br::Transform*, transform, NULL)
static QHash<QString, Template> cache;
static QMutex cacheLock;
public:
~CacheTransform()
{
if (cache.isEmpty()) return;
// Write to cache
QFile file("Cache");
if (!file.open(QFile::WriteOnly))
qFatal("Unable to open %s for writing.", qPrintable(file.fileName()));
QDataStream stream(&file);
stream << cache;
file.close();
}
private:
void init()
{
if (!transform) return;
trainable = transform->trainable;
if (!cache.isEmpty()) return;
// Read from cache
QFile file("Cache");
if (file.exists()) {
if (!file.open(QFile::ReadOnly))
qFatal("Unable to open %s for reading.", qPrintable(file.fileName()));
QDataStream stream(&file);
stream >> cache;
file.close();
}
}
void train(const QList<TemplateList> &data)
{
transform->train(data);
}
void project(const Template &src, Template &dst) const
{
const QString &file = src.file;
if (cache.contains(file)) {
dst = cache[file];
} else {
transform->project(src, dst);
cacheLock.lock();
cache[file] = dst;
cacheLock.unlock();
}
}
};
QHash<QString, Template> CacheTransform::cache;
QMutex CacheTransform::cacheLock;
BR_REGISTER(Transform, CacheTransform)
} // namespace br
#include "core/cache.moc"
